5.0 out of 5 stars Software developer's dream., October 27, 2005
By Reuben Gathright "rgathright" (United States)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)    (VINE VOICE)   
I use this printer to print cards for a poker player's club software package I wrote. I was able to print 400 color cards with no problem (hang ups). The printer can easily interface with Microsoft Access reporting capabilties. USB interface made it a snap to install on the client's workstation.

My office got hit by Hurricane Rita. This model printer was the only one to survive water damage. I know that is not important, but it shows it has good construction.

I gave it 5 stars for dependability. If you want anything else from a card printer in regards to speed or superior photo quality, you will need to spend over $2000.

5.0 out of 5 stars A great card maker, September 17, 2008
By Jager (San Francisco, CA) - See all my reviews
Finding reviews for this thing was not easy. I decided to take the risk and try out this printer - and I'm glad I did. Full color, awesome quality. I use this for membership cards and was able to produce some great cards.

A few things to know.
First, this printer does NOT come with a printing ribbon - so be sure to buy one of those too. Get a YMCKO ribbon for full color goodness. It also doesn't come with a USB cable - pretty standard though. However it does come with both a US power cable and a European power cable.

This thing is fast, fairly quiet, feels sturdy, and it's awesome. Be sure to get the card making software off their website (asure ID) - it's free for most simple purposes - certainly does what I need it to do.

The footprint of this printer is pretty small - which I like. It doesn't ever turn fully off so I just unplug it when I'm done.

All in all no complaints - it does what it's supposed to do and it does it very well. This is the card printer you're looking for!
